How to Choose the Right Drywall Services in Illinois

Choosing the right drywall services in Illinois involves researching credentials, comparing quotes and services, and ensuring the contractor has solid experience and good local references.

Key Steps for Selecting Drywall Services

  • Check Licensing and Insurance: Verify that the contractor is licensed (where required) and carries proper insurance to protect against liability and damages. Even though Illinois does not have specific licensing for general contractors everywhere, always ask for documentation.
  • Evaluate Experience and Past Work: Ask how many years the company has been in business, what types of drywall jobs they’ve done, and request references or photo samples of previous projects similar to yours. Experienced services should provide detailed portfolios.
  • Compare Multiple Quotes: Request at least three detailed estimates to compare pricing, timelines, and contract terms. Beware of quotes that appear suspiciously low, as quality work and materials require fair compensation.
  • Research Reviews and Get References: Look up reviews through the Better Business Bureau, Google, and local platforms. Ask for direct references, especially for jobs completed in your area. Speak to previous clients about their satisfaction and the contractor’s communication, cleanliness, and adherence to deadlines.
  • Ask Key Questions: Clarify the project timeline, payment structure, and whether the contractor provides warranties or satisfaction guarantees. Find out if subcontractors will be used and if they are vetted and insured.

Important Questions to Ask

  • How long have you been providing drywall services?
  • Can you show proof of insurance and licensing?
  • What is the estimated timeline and cost for the project?
  • Do you offer any warranty or satisfaction guarantee?
  • Can I see recent examples of your work and speak to past clients?
  • Will you handle permits if needed?
  • Who will be my main contact during the project?

Practical Tips

  • Balance cost and quality; cheapest isn’t always best.
  • Prefer local companies with headquarters nearby, increasing accountability and faster follow-up.
  • Ensure they are familiar with specialized drywall (e.g., moisture- or fire-resistant, or soundproofing) if your project needs it.

By following these steps and asking focused questions, it’s possible to choose a reputable, reliable drywall service in Illinois that delivers high-quality results.
